When you're in need of a quick, no-cook, make-ahead breakfast, chia pudding checks all the boxes. You can even keep jars of it in the fridge for snacks or dessert. But sweet, satisfying chia pudding offers more than convenience. It boasts all the nutritional benefits of chia seeds, such as fiber, protein, omega-3s, and antioxidants. Dig in.
